Output e6707d9b68665c1f29c6faac03868a58d6b97ebe11b4e66d0e7711f1a27eb01f:0

value
850866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ec31751818004ea705fc5f124288a815330425b OP_EQUAL
address
3DFGmt3CHeboeMeL36bsXS8BCZ3h5Eea6Y
transaction
e6707d9b68665c1f29c6faac03868a58d6b97ebe11b4e66d0e7711f1a27eb01f
spent
true